Hey, quick handover on Plinkstore. The bloom filter in front of the KV layer got resized last night after false positives crept past 2%. Rehash is done, but keep an eye on the miss-rate graph — if it spikes again, don't rebuild during peak, just widen the filter. Tomas left notes on sizing math. The dashboard and rebuild procedure live on the internal page below.

operations page: https://jenkins.zemvarcloud.local/job/merge_requests/repo/build/73930b4b30f0a8ed

### v4.1 — Renamed load-test auth setting

Quick note for the security review: we renamed the variable that Stresslark uses to authenticate against the Quickcart checkout sandbox. The old name was ambiguous and kept getting mistaken for a prod credential, which nobody wants. Behavior is identical; only the name changed. In the sandbox `.env`, the renamed credential now appears on the following line.

sealed setting: ARCHIVE_KEY3=8d0

// Renderfjord transcode farm: worker tuning knobs.
// Quick context for the eng sync: we bumped chunk sizes after the
// Tuesday backlog, since short chunks were thrashing the scheduler
// and GPUs sat idle between segments. Retry backoff is deliberately
// aggressive — upstream storage flakes recover fast, and waiting
// longer just grows the queue. Don't touch the concurrency cap
// without checking thermal headroom on the Brindle racks first.
// Current values, with rationale inline, are listed below.

limits module of fajog-tawig:
RATE_LIMITS = {
    "druwyn": 2,
    "quenael": 10,
    "wenix": 2,
    "druael": 2,
}

## 2.8.1 — Key rotation

Rotated the signing key for FuelTrace, the fleet fuel-usage report generator. Old key retired after the Dunmarsh depot incident review flagged its age. All report bundles from 2.8.1 onward are signed with the new key; verification of older bundles still works via the archived keyring. Reviewers: confirm the CI pipeline references the updated key ID and that the verifier rejects bundles signed with the retired key. No functional changes to report output. The new signing key is below.

signing key of bagap-yawep = bky13_TbfT6ZMUoGJo2